Chimney sweeping services involve the thorough cleaning of a chimney’s interior to remove soot, creosote buildup, and other debris. This process helps ensure that the chimney functions efficiently and reduces the risk of fire hazards caused by flammable deposits.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to access the chimney’s flue and clean it effectively, often including inspections to identify any potential issues that may require repairs or further maintenance. Regular sweeping is recommended to maintain optimal performance and safety for fireplaces, wood stoves, and other vented heating appliances.
One of the primary problems that chimney sweeping addresses is the accumulation of creosote, a byproduct of burning wood or other fuels. When creosote builds up inside the chimney, it can restrict airflow, decrease heating efficiency, and increase the risk of chimney fires. Additionally, sweeping can help identify and remove blockages such as bird nests, leaves, or other debris that may obstruct the venting system. By removing these obstructions, chimney sweeping services contribute to safer operation and help prevent dangerous conditions that could lead to smoke or carbon monoxide entering indoor spaces.

Cost Range - Chimney sweeping services typically cost between $100 and $300 for a standard inspection and cleaning. Prices may vary based on chimney size, condition, and location, with some services charging around $150 on average in Woodbridge, NJ. Additional services or extensive cleaning can increase the overall cost.
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ense for chimney sweeping depends on the chimney’s height, accessibility, and the complexity of the cleaning process. For example, a straightforward sweep might be around $100, while more complicated jobs could reach $250 or more.
Service Inclusions - Most chimney sweeping services include removing creosote buildup, debris, and inspecting the chimney’s interior for potential issues. The typical cost covers these standard procedures, with extra charges applying for repairs or extensive inspections.
Price Variations - Costs can fluctuate based on the provider and local market conditions, with some offering package deals or bundled services. In Woodbridge, NJ, the average range remains consistent, but specific quotes should be obtained from local service providers for precise pricing.

How often should chimney sweeping be performed? It is generally recommended to have a chimney swept at least once a year to ensure proper function and safety.
What are the signs that a chimney needs cleaning? Signs include soot or creosote buildup, unpleasant odors, smoke backup, or reduced draft during use.
What types of chimneys can local pros service? They typically service wood-burning, gas, and pellet stove chimneys, among other types.
Is chimney sweeping necessary if I rarely use my fireplace? Yes, periodic cleaning is advised to prevent creosote buildup and ensure safety when using the fireplace.
